nanekawâsis
Thursday, August 6 - 6pm
Cinéma du Musée
Directed by Conor McNally
Canada 2024 1h20 – v.o.a. et Nêhiyawêwin STA
Torn from his family and community during the Sixties Scoop, George Littlechild reconnected with his Indigenous roots as an adult and received the ancestral name nanekawâsis, meaning “lively child.” Through his vibrant paintings and his journey as a Two-Spirit person, he transforms his personal history and the injustices suffered by Indigenous peoples into a work of forgiveness, remembrance, and resilience.
